Feyenoord youngster in Gunners link

Luc Castaignos' agent has claimed the Feyenoord teenager would be willing to sign for Arsenal. The highly-rated 16-year-old has reportedly attracted interest from a number of clubs, with the Gunners said to be favourites to land his signature. Castaignos' representative, Arie Treffers, has stated the striker is open to agreeing a deal with Arsene Wenger's Arsenal, provided he can remain at Feyenoord on loan to help aid is development. "Luc needs to develop at his own pace," Castaignos told Sportweek. "For this reason he will be best served by remaining here. "He realises that this move will be good for his career, but he will only sign for Arsenal if the club is prepared to let him stay on loan. "If that does not happen he will remain under contract at Feyenoord." Meanwhile, Feyenoord have secured the transfer of Dani Fernandez from Ukrainian side Arsenal Kiev, the defender penning a three-year deal with the Dutch club.
